Saprissa tie Pachuca in first-leg of 2008 Champions’ Cup Final
Costa Rica’s Deportivo Saprissa played to a 1:1 tie against visiting Pachuca CF of Mexico in the first-leg of the 2008 CONCACAF Champions’ Cup™ Final at the Estadio Ricardo Saprissa in San José on Wednesday evening.

Last Champions’ Cup Final Begins Tonight
Since its inception in 1962, 47 years of CONCACAF Champions’ Cup™ competition has produced a total of 26 different champions from nine different countries. Saprissa overturn first-leg loss to win final Champions’ Cup semifinal spot
Costa Rica’s Deportivo Saprissa overcame a 2:1 deficit from the first-leg last week in Mexico, defeating Atlante CF 3:0 in front of a passionate and animated full house in San Jose, to secure the last remaining spot in the CONCACAF Champions’ Cup semifinals.

D.C. United advance to Champions’ Cup Semifinals
US side D.C. United became the first team to advance to the semifinals of the last ever CONCACAF Champions’ Cup with a 6:1 aggregate defeat of 2007 CFU Champions Harbour View of Jamaica.

Atlante record first win of the final Champions’ Cup
After three successive draws in the opening fixtures of the 2008 CONCACAF Champions’ Cup™, Mexican side Atlante FC recorded the first win of the final edition of the tournament when they defeated Deportivo Saprissa 2:1 in the last first-leg quarterfinal.
